opsi 4.0: Updates in testing:

Antworten
Benutzeravatar
d.oertel
uib-Team
Beiträge: 3319
Registriert: 04 Jun 2008, 14:27

opsi 4.0: Updates in testing:

Beitrag von d.oertel »

Dear opsi users

Hereby we release some updates for testing packages and some new testing packages.
These are the final opsi 4.0 testing updates for the packages that are released as testing in the last weeks.
At the moment we plan to release these packages as stable on Tuesday 19.12.2017.

New in testing is the package opsi-local-image-restore_4.0.7.4-5.
We removed the property 'method' in this package and the method
'partclone-image-restore' will be always used.
The background is that the method "rsync-partclone-image" has no relevant
speed advantages on SATA hard disks but may destroy windows 10 file system
because it fails on symlinks and junctions.

Happy Testing

In details:

As testing we publish:


Netboot products in the version 4.0.7.4-7

win10_4.0.7.4-7.opsi
win10-captured_4.0.7.4-7.opsi
win10-x64_4.0.7.4-7.opsi
win10-x64-captured_4.0.7.4-7.opsi
win2008-r2_4.0.7.4-7.opsi
win2012_4.0.7.4-7.opsi
win2012-r2_4.0.7.4-7.opsi
win2016_4.0.7.4-7.opsi
win7_4.0.7.4-7.opsi
win7-captured_4.0.7.4-7.opsi
win7-x64_4.0.7.4-7.opsi
win7-x64-captured_4.0.7.4-7.opsi
win81_4.0.7.4-7.opsi
win81-captured_4.0.7.4-7.opsi
win81-x64-captured_4.0.7.4-7.opsi
win81--x64-captured_4.0.7.4-7.opsi

Localboot products

opsi-winst 4.12.0.11
opsi-client-agent_4.0.7.24-2
opsi-script-test 4.12.0.11


opsi-linux products:

Linux Netboot products:

debian (4.0.7.2-5)
sles12sp1 (4.0.7.2-3)

Linux Localboot products

l-system-update 4.0.7.1-6
l-ssh-root-login (1.0-3)


opsi-local-image:

opsi-local-image-restore_4.0.7.4-5.opsi

opsi-local-image-win10_4.0.7.4-5.opsi
opsi-local-image-win10-capture_4.0.7.4-5.opsi
opsi-local-image-win10-x64_4.0.7.4-5.opsi
opsi-local-image-win10-x64-capture_4.0.7.4-5.opsi
opsi-local-image-win7_4.0.7.4-5.opsi
opsi-local-image-win7-capture_4.0.7.4-5.opsi
opsi-local-image-win7-x64_4.0.7.4-5.opsi
opsi-local-image-win7-x64-capture_4.0.7.4-5.opsi
opsi-local-image-win81_4.0.7.4-5.opsi
opsi-local-image-win81-capture_4.0.7.4-5.opsi
opsi-local-image-win81-x64_4.0.7.4-5.opsi
opsi-local-image-win81-x64-capture_4.0.7.4-5.opsi


Server packages:

none


detlef oertel


Changelogs:
=======================================================

opsi-client-agent (4.0.7.24-2) stable; urgency=low

* update to opsi-script 4.12.0.11

-- Detlef Oertel <d.oertel@uib.de> Tue, 12 Dec 2017:15:00:00 +0200

opsi-client-agent (4.0.7.24-1) stable; urgency=low

* update to opsi-notifier 4.0.7.3
* notifier_json: method choicesChanged ; fixes #3196
* notifierguicontrol: objectByIndex: do not crash on wrong ini content ; fixes #3156
* dpi awareness: Vista-8:off; 8.1+:per Monitor
* new dir c:\opsi.org\applog which is open for user and should have the logs from systray and kiosk-client
* update to opsi_client_systray 4.0.7.3
* oslog: changed logging to c:\opsi.org\applog
* DataModuleCreate: initlogging: logfilename := 'systray-' + GetUserName_ ;
* DataModuleCreate: setlogvel to 7
* DataModuleCreate: check for opsiclientd
* update to opsiclientkiosk 4.0.7.12
* oslog: changed logging to c:\opsi.org\applog
* ockdata: initlogging: logfilename := 'kiosk-' + GetUserName_ +'.log';
* ockdata: readconf: setlogvel to 7
* code cleanup
* ockdata: main: check for opsiclientd ; fixes #3225
* use delete in Files_redist_cleanup_c / Files_redist_cleanup_d ; fixes #3227

-- Detlef Oertel <d.oertel@uib.de> Tue, 05 Dec 2017:15:00:00 +0200

opsi-client-agent (4.0.7.23-4) stable; urgency=low

* remove of some del -s Options (bug created in last Version)
* removed unused section DosInAnIcon_lock_opsiclientd_conf
* unused file opsicliend.reg

-- Detlef Oertel <d.oertel@uib.de> Mon, 06 Oct 2017:15:00:00 +0200

opsi-client-agent (4.0.7.23-3) stable; urgency=low

* use 'sc failure' to configure opsiclientd service restarts after failure
* use allway -c option in delete and copy to avoid not wanted reboots

-- Detlef Oertel <d.oertel@uib.de> Mon, 02 Oct 2017:15:00:00 +0200

opsi-client-agent (4.0.7.23-2) stable; urgency=low

* Files_del_systray: Fixed wrong path.
* Trying to kill notifier.exe before copying

-- Erol Ueluekmen <e.ueluekmen@uib.de> Thu, 28 Sep 2017:14:00:00 +0200

=======================================================

opsi-winst/opsi-script (4.12.0.11) stable; urgency=low

* Additional fix for Support brackets '[]' in Registry keys
* osfunc: function posFromEnd(const substr : string; const s : string) : integer;
* osparser: doRegistryHack: openkey, deletekey in Registry sections
* osparser: evaluatestring: GetRegistryStringValue*

-- Detlef Oertel <d.oertel@uib.de> Wed, 12 Dec 2017:15:00:00 +0200


opsi-winst/opsi-script (4.12.0.10) stable; urgency=low

* osdefinedfunctions: TOsDefinedFunction.call: free local Vars on leaving the function; fixes #3230
* Fix call of defined functions inside if statement ; fixes #3232
* osdefinedfunctions: call: new param Nestlevel
* osparser: evaluatestring: new param Nestlevel (to use while call defined function)
* osparser: producestringlist: new param Nestlevel (to use while call defined function)
* osparser: doSetVar: new param Nestlevel (to use while call evaluatestring/producestringlist)
* Support brackets '[]' in Registry keys ; fixes #2825
* osparser: doRegistryHack: openkey, deletekey in Registry sections
* osparser: evaluatestring: GetRegistryStringValue*
* Encoding Parameter for sections which modify files (patches,Patchtext,...); references #3140
* osencoding: LoadFromFileWithEncoding
* osparser: doIniFilesPatchesMain: shortcut for utf8
* other encoding Problems:
* osencoding: reencode: encode by Default to utf8 which is the internal encoding
* osencoding: LoadFromFileWithEncoding (more changes)

-- Detlef Oertel <d.oertel@uib.de> Wed, 06 Dec 2017:15:00:00 +0200

opsi-winst/opsi-script (4.12.0.9) stable; urgency=low

* osmain: log command line parameter of opsi-script call
* osmain: startprogrammodes: fix for /productid (bug created with /logproductid)

-- Detlef Oertel <d.oertel@uib.de> Mon, 06 Nov 2017:15:00:00 +0200

opsi-winst/opsi-script (4.12.0.8) stable; urgency=low

* start to wor on new modifier '/encoding <encoding>' for patches sections
* osparser: fix Message 'ReportMessages' changed to 'ScriptErrorMessages'
* osparser: fix Message 'ScriptErrorMessages' 'is set to' true/false was wrong
* osparser: tsImportLib: replace constants

-- Detlef Oertel <d.oertel@uib.de> Mon, 06 Nov 2017:15:00:00 +0200

=================================================
opsi-local-image-restore (4.0.7.4-5) stable; urgency=low

* remove method "rsync-partclone-image"
* remove property method
* change setup.py
* now always using method 'partclone-image-restore'

-- detlef oertel <d.oertel@uib.de> Fri, 08 Dec 2017 15:00:00 +0200

=================================================

windows (4.0.7.4-7) / opsi-local-image (4.0.7.4-5)

* deleting unattend.xml in cleanup script

-- Mathias Radtke <m.radtke@uib.de> Thu Nov 30 14:01:28 2017 +0200


windows (4.0.7.4-6) stable; urgency)low

* nt6.py: support for #@installdiskindex*# placeholder in unattend.xml
* nt6.xml: support for #@installdiskindex*# placeholder in unattend.xml

-- Detlef Oertel <d.oertel@uib.de> Thu, 09 Nov 2017:15:00:00 +0200

windows (4.0.7.4-5) stable; urgency)low

* nt6.py: lookup table for localized adminstrator accounts
* nt6.opsiscript: call setup.exe from installfiles_dir
* nt6.xml: use #@adminName*# instead of 'administrator'
* win2016: default password is Nt123?

-- Detlef Oertel <d.oertel@uib.de> Thu, 02 Nov 2017:15:00:00 +0200


windows (4.0.7.4-4) stable; urgency)low

* nt6.py: minor fixes
* nt6.opsiscript: minor fixes
* opsisetuplib.py: minor fixes

-- Detlef Oertel <d.oertel@uib.de> Thu, 12 Oct 2017:15:00:00 +0200

windows (4.0.7.4-3) stable; urgency)low

* nt6.py: check if correct opsi-script is available
* nt6.py: check for <productid>.png or windows.png' before copy
* nt6.opsiscript: check for <productid>.png or windows.png' before ShowBitmap
* Makefile: copy windows.png as windows.png (makes work with derivated products easyer)
* nt6.py: Show message about productId_ver-ver on clientId
* removed property: blockalignment - now always true

-- Detlef Oertel <d.oertel@uib.de> Thu, 12 Oct 2017:15:00:00 +0200

windows (4.0.7.4-2) experimental; urgency)low

* merge from 4.0.7.1-10: nt6.py check for opsi version opsi 4.1 compatible
* nt6.py: make sure that encodedPcpatchPassword is defined
* uefi: create system partition: more info

-- Detlef Oertel <d.oertel@uib.de> Thu, 05 Oct 2017:15:00:00 +0200

windows (4.0.7.4-1) experimental; urgency)low

* integrate use of opsi-script in winpe part
* new nt6.opsiscript
* modified nt6.py: changed work.cmd additonal opsi-script-infos.ini
* new property: multi_disk_mode with values: ["0","1","2","3","prefer_ssd","prefer_rotaional"]
Fallback is first disk
* moving postinst stuff from c:\tmp to c:\opsi.org\log
* removed setwallpaper, opsimbr.exe
* fix 99_cleanup.cmd: path to 64bit shutdown.exe
* opsisetuplib.py: added sleep prior making NTFS partition (mr 4.0.7.1-9)
* update pci.ids, usb.ids ; fixes: #2747
* new property: administrator_password ; fixes: #2396
* new property: winpe_dir ;default=auto; auto=winpe or winpe_uefi, if not auto: used for mbr and uefi; fixes: #2922
* winpe_uefi is a symlink to winpe by default ; fixes: #2863
* postinst and preinst now created from postinst_nt6 and preinst_nt6
* nt5 stuff removed
* winpe* is backuped and restored in preinst/postinst
* create winpe_uefi as symlink if not existing (do)
* postinst.cmd now also allows calling powershell scripts (*.ps1) ; fixes: #2677

-- Detlef Oertel <d.oertel@uib.de> Thu, 24 Aug 2017:15:00:00 +0200

=================================================

opsi-wim-capture (4.0.7.2-7) stable; urgency=low

* suspends the product if event on_shutdown is detected and < win8.1
* capture.opsiscript: no more setloglevel

-- detlef oertel <d.oertel@uib.de> Mo, 06 Nov 2017 15:00:00 +0000

opsi-wim-capture (4.0.7.2-6) stable; urgency=low

* set opsi-clonezilla property disk_device and use 'diskdevice' in property runcommand
* uefi support
* multi disk support

-- detlef oertel <d.oertel@uib.de> Mo, 30 Oct 2017 15:00:00 +0000

opsi-wim-capture (4.0.7.2-5) stable; urgency=low

* more fixes for win < 8.1
* more fixes for more than one disk

-- detlef oertel <d.oertel@uib.de> Wed, 25 Oct 2017 15:00:00 +0000

opsi-wim-capture (4.0.7.2-4) stable; urgency=low

* fix: added declaration for $aktNumber$

-- rupert roeder <r.roeder@uib.de> Wed, 25 Oct 2017 09:45:00 +0000

opsi-wim-capture (4.0.7.2-3) stable; urgency=low

* fix at "Check for active (boot) disk ..."

-- detlef oertel <d.oertel@uib.de> Mon, 23 Oct 2017 15:00:00 +0000

opsi-wim-capture (4.0.7.2-2) stable; urgency=low

* new property image_flag: Flag will be set after capture
* set flag also after creat via dism
* update auf wimlib 1.12

-- detlef oertel <d.oertel@uib.de> Wed, 04 Oct 2017 15:00:00 +0000

opsi-wim-capture (4.0.7.2-1) stable; urgency=low

* try to include sysprep logs
* call method updateWIMConfig
* fixed ShellInAnIcon_imagex_flags
* fix create work.cmd for different netboot product versions
* start opsi-script in PE with /logproductid
* stop service tiledatamodelsvc before sysprep
* use powershell to get boot drive
* do not use WINDOWS Label to get captutre Drive Letter

-- detlef oertel <d.oertel@uib.de> Wed, 06 Sep 2017 15:00:00 +0000


opsi-wim-capture (4.0.7.1-5) stable; urgency=low

* workaround for setProductActionRequestWithDependencies (none Bug)

-- detlef oertel <d.oertel@uib.de> Thu, 20 Jul 2017 15:00:00 +0000

=================================================
opsi-clonezilla (4.0.7.2-4) stable; urgency=low

* quickfix smb1 fallback

-- detlef oertel <d.oertel@uib.de> Wed, 25 Nov 2017 15:00:00 +0200
=================================================
debian (4.0.7.2-5) stable; urgency=low

* Debian9 now installs with working network confiuration

-- Mathias Radtke <m.radtke@uib.de> Wed nov 23 15:20:00 +0100

=================================================

sles12sp1 (4.0.7.2-3) stable; urgency=low

* replaced opsi4.0 check with an opsi4.x check

-- Mathias Radtke <m.radtke@uib.de> Wed Oct 4 13:43:06 2017 +0200

=================================================
l-ssh-root-login (1.0-3) stable; urgency=low

* added debian9 compatability

-- Mathias Radtke <m.radtke@uib.de> Wed, 26 Jul 2017 13:28:00 +0200

l-ssh-root-login (1.0-2) stable; urgency=low

* PermitRootLogin prohibit-password now detected

-- Mathias Radtke <m.radtke@uib.de> Mon, 13 Feb 2017 14:55:00 +0100

=================================================

l-system-update 4.0.7.1-6 stable urgency=low

* Requiring opsi-winst/opsi-script 4.11.6.
* Cleaned up script.
* RedHat: Running yum makecache before attempting to update.
* UCS: Refactored waiting for package lock.
* Increased initial waiting time for the package lock.
* Running on an unsupported distro family will fail.

-- Niko Wenselowski <m.radtke@uib.de> Thu, 17 Nov 2017 12:40:07 +0100

l-system-update 4.0.7.1-5 stable urgency=low

* univention upgrade: retrying twice when failed to upgrade

-- Mathias Radtke <m.radtke@uib.de> Thu, 09 Nov 2017 16:10:00 +0100
=================================================

opsi-script-test (4.12.0.11-1) stable; urgency=low

* registry:
* fix for Support brackets '[]' in Registry keys ; fixes #2825
* osparser: doRegistryHack: openkey, deletekey in Registry sections
* osparser: evaluatestring: GetRegistryStringValue*

-- detlef oertel <d.oertel@uib.de> Tue, 12 Dec 2017 15:00:00 +0200

opsi-script-test (4.12.0.10-1) stable; urgency=low

* test local functions:
* Testing repeated function call with local variables
* Testing fuction call while if
* registry:
* Support brackets '[]' in Registry keys ; fixes #2825
* osparser: doRegistryHack: openkey, deletekey in Registry sections
* osparser: evaluatestring: GetRegistryStringValue*

-- detlef oertel <d.oertel@uib.de> Mon, 06 Dec 2017 15:00:00 +0200

opsi-script-test (4.12.0.8-1) stable; urgency=low

* test encoding:Patches /encoding "ucs2be"

-- detlef oertel <d.oertel@uib.de> Mon, 23 Oct 2017 15:00:00 +0200

=================================================
opsi support - uib gmbh

For productive opsi installations we recommend support contracts.
http://www.uib.de
http://www.opsi.org
Antworten